How much do temporary java production support jobs pay per hour?

As of May 30, 2026, the average hourly pay for temporary java production support in Glenview, IL is $51.62,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42.69 and $56.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Temporary Java Production Support vs Java Application Developer?

AspectTemporary Java Production SupportJava Application Developer
Primary RoleMaintains and supports existing Java applications in production environmentsDesigns, develops, and implements new Java applications and features
Work EnvironmentFast-paced, operational, often on-site or remote supportDevelopment-focused, project-based, often in an office setting
Required SkillsJava, troubleshooting, monitoring tools, problem-solvingJava, software design, coding, testing
CertificationsJava certifications helpful but not mandatoryJava certifications beneficial for career growth

Temporary Java Production Support focuses on maintaining and troubleshooting existing Java applications in live environments, ensuring stability and performance. In contrast, Java Application Developers create new applications and features, emphasizing design and development. Both roles require Java skills, but their daily tasks and objectives differ significantly.

Job description

A DAY IN THE LIFE:

The Production Support Engineering team plays a key role at FIS Amount by ensuring production issues are managed efficiently and effectively. You will manage high-priority issues to resolution following industry best practices. You'll troubleshoot, fix, and apply workarounds to resolve technical issues across multiple platforms.  Each day, you'll interact with every aspect of our organization to find the best solution for our partner.  Management of ticket queues, monitoring for issues and post-release validation are also a large part of this role, all while meeting our partners' SLA requirements.   

Team: This role interacts with nearly every group within the organization, including engineering, product, QA, customer success and others. 
Salary: $73,000-$80,000 base salary

Similar job titles: Production Support, Production Support Analyst, Incident Manager, Incident Coordinator, IT Major Incident Manager, Application Support Engineer, Support Engineer

WHAT WE'LL TRUST YOU TO DELIVER:

  • Technical ability to deep dive into issues by querying tables, analyzing data and problem-solving
  • Prioritization and triage of incoming requests/issues 
  • Drive incident resolution and lead conversations with cross-functional groups.   Ask the right questions to help determine impact/priority and the correct route for resolution.  Oversee a technical bridge, if required.
  • Management of all incidents through the incident management lifecycle
  • Documentation of all relevant events, getting status reports while driving decision-making and resolution 
  • Ensure stakeholders are updated according to predefined service level agreements
  • Completion and ownership of the postmortem with appropriate root cause analysis performed  
  • Improvement suggestions to capture preventative measures that will avoid recurrences of incidents
  • Investigate patterns that indicate larger overall issues, even if we don't have the solution. 
  • Compilation of metrics on a weekly and monthly basis.  Maintain dashboards for service incidents and ad hoc reporting as requested
  • Play an active role during critical incidents which may occur outside of normal business hours.  Nights, weekends, and holidays on an on-call rotation basis is a must
  • Creation of runbooks or standard operating procedures (SOP) so we can all learn from each other and add to our knowledge base

WHAT YOU LIKELY BRING TO THE TABLE: 

  • Technical and/or engineering background, ideally with experience writing SQL queries
  • Experience working with development teams in a fast-paced environment
  • Basic knowledge or interest of any programming language such as Java, Python or Ruby 
  • 2 years of experience coordinating and executing major incidents, with demonstrated capacity to lead under pressure
  • Previously collaborated with a wide spectrum of internal and external stakeholders
  • Worked in an organization with a complex business environment
  • Leadership skills with the ability to make quick decisions
  • Familiar with ITSM/ITIL concepts
  • You thrive being a self-starter, who can lead others during stressful situations
  • Familiar with tools such as Confluence, Jira, and on-call management software such as PagerDuty and experience with error monitoring software (Sentry, Kibana)
